草庐IT

mongodb - Meteor/ReactJS - UI 闪烁问题 : rendering twice before and after checking a database

任务:我需要根据数据库结果显示组件。问题:它在检查数据库之前渲染组件并在不从数据库获取任何信息的情况下显示结果,并且在从数据库收到结果后第二次渲染组件,这会导致UI闪烁问题**在我的示例中(...删除...)我展示了它。一旦至少添加了一项任务,刷新页面和“添加任务!”前半秒将显示红色block。如何解决这个问题?我应该使用“promise”还是只有在它检查数据库后我才能显示结果? 最佳答案 您的容器订阅数据并监控订阅的就绪状态:createContainer(()=>{consttodosHandle=Meteor.subscrib

【Unity入门计划】基本概念(6)-精灵渲染器 Sprite Renderer

目录官方文档1Sprite精灵2SpriteRenderer精灵渲染器2.1Sprite精灵2.2Color着色2.3Filp翻转2.4DrawMode当前的绘制模式9-slicingSprites9切片精灵2.5MaskInteraction遮罩交互SpriteMasks精灵遮罩2.6 SpriteSortPoint精灵排序点2.7Material材质2.8Layer图层相关由于在学习Unity教程的Ruby'sAdventure教程过程中,遇到了精灵渲染器这个组件,想对它做一个简单的学习,因此一下举例的截图均基于这个官方提供的项目。官方文档精灵渲染器(SpriteRenderer)-Uni

angularjs - 如何同时res.json和res.render,传mongo db给angularjs?

我用的是jade模板引擎自带的express。app.js//viewenginesetupapp.set('views',path.join(__dirname,'views'));app.set('viewengine','jade');对于每个模板,我需要有res.render来呈现htmlheader,如果我不使用res.render,模板/页面不会显示。routes/index.jsrouter.get('/',function(req,res,next){res.render('index',{title:'Bookshop'});});router.get('/data'

mongodb - Node/ express /蒙戈 : How do I render HTML attributes from dynamic content?

我使用Node/Express/Mongo/Jade(和/或HAML.js)制作了一个简单的博客。我使用(并稍微更新)了这个tutorial的博客应用程序,它本身是来自howtonode.org的一个更新我可以使用模板引擎渲染链接等属性,但当我从数据库传递数据时,没有任何html渲染。我得到HTML的纯文本打印输出。我认为我需要一些其他Node包/模块来呈现“动态”内容,但我不知道从哪里开始。 最佳答案 在jade中,当您传递不想被转义的内容时,请确保将其传递为!=而不是=不过要格外小心!如果您不手动解析不良内容,可能会使您的网站极

“Property or method “***“ is not defined on the instance but referenced during render.”报错的原因及解决方案

报错问题:在使用vue-cli运行项目的过程中,在VScode中不报错,但在浏览器调试工具中发出 [Vuewarn]:Propertyormethod"******"isnotdefinedontheinstancebutreferencedduringrender.Makesurethatthispropertyisreactive,eitherinthedataoption,orforclass-basedcomponents,byinitializingtheproperty.的报错。报错原因:属性或方法“list”未在实例上定义,但在渲染期间被引用。通过初始化该属性,确保该属性是被动的

RENDER RDLC报告的性能问题

我们在我的MVC.NET应用程序中使用RDLC报告。当数据花费超过5分钟的时间渲染该报告时,我们能够以几秒钟的速度获取数据。我们在Crystal报告中使用了相同的报告,仅需1分钟即可渲染该报告。但是,我们已经在报告中使用了分组,但我认为RDLC报告应该比Crystal报告快。您能提出任何提高本报告绩效的想法。reportViewer.LocalReport.Refresh();reportViewer.ProcessingMode=ProcessingMode.Local;reportViewer.SizeToReportContent=true;reportViewer.AsyncRende

Unity-URP 动态设置Camera.Rendering的参数

urp中Camera的Rendering.Renderer里的选项是取决于GraphicsSetting.Scriptabe;RenderPipelineSettings的URPAsset//URP中的摄像机参数基本会使用该API来修改varcamData= Camera.main.GetUniversalAdditionalCameraData();一.动态修改项目的UniversalRenderPipelineAsset(以下简称URPAsset)varurpAsset=ResourceManager.LoadAsset("UrpAssets/UrpAssetsName")Graphics

如何通过代码在Unity设置URP通用渲染管线资源的画质选项、后处理效果、渲染分辨率、抗锯齿效果、Renderer Features等效果并制作一个可以设置它们的UI

  Hello喔这里是没有鱼的猫先生,本期文章的主题佬们有看到标题了QWQ  当使用Urp管道项目时,我们需要在一个Urp通用管线资源的项目中修改它的各种效果以玩家自己设置不同的画质需求,那下面这个通用脚本便诞生了,它也许并不适用于所有的场景,但是相信应用过它后可以给初学Urp渲染管线资源的您提供如何去修改画质选项等功能的新思路。(⁠*⁠´⁠ω⁠`⁠*⁠)                     通常情况下在使用Urp通用管线资源的项目中的源代码脚本挂上物体并赋值必须赋值的变量后成功运行效果如上。 :D   在了解到脚本的内容之后,你可以将其中UI部分删除,并整合到你的代码当中去,以给你的项目

论文笔记《3D Gaussian Splatting for Real-Time Radiance Field Rendering》

项目地址原论文Abstract最近辐射场方法彻底改变了多图/视频场景捕获的新视角合成。然而取得高视觉质量仍需神经网络花费大量时间训练和渲染,同时最近较快的方法都无可避免地以质量为代价。对于无边界的完整场景(而不是孤立的对象)和1080p分辨率渲染,目前没有任何方法能达到实时显示率。我们引入了三个关键元素,使得能够达到sota视觉质量同时保证有竞争力的训练时间,而且重要的是可以高质量、实时(≥30fps\ge30fps≥30fps)、1080p分辨率的情况下新视角合成。首先,从摄像机校准过程中产生的稀疏点开始,我们用三维高斯来表示场景,既保留了用于场景优化的连续容积辐射场的理想特性,又避免了在空

第二十七节:Vue渲染函数Render

前言:通过前面的学习,我们已经知道了在vue中,如何使用template模板编写组件,但是使用模板并不是唯一能让vue知道应该在页面显示什么内容的方法,那接下来看看其他的方式Render函数是Vue2.x新增的一个函数、主要用来提升节点的性能,它是基于JavaScript计算。使用Render函数将Template里面的节点解析成虚拟的Dom。Vue推荐在绝大多数情况下使用模板来创建你的HTML。然而在一些场景中,你真的需要JavaScript的完全编程的能力。这时你可以用渲染函数,它比模板更接近编译器。简而言之:在Vue中使用模板HTML语法组建页面,使用Render函数是为了让我们用Js语